#!/usr/bin/env bash # scripts/admin-mfa-reset-all.sh # Issue #18 — v1.6.0 — Emergency: disable MFA for ALL users in one call. # # This is a break-glass tool. It calls POST /api/mfa/admin-reset-all on the # backend with a strict, double-confirmed body and writes the action into the # server's audit log (action=mfa.disabled.admin_bulk_reset). All users will be # able to log in with username/password alone afterwards and must re-enroll if # they want MFA again. # # Usage: # ./scripts/admin-mfa-reset-all.sh # API_URL=https://hap.example.com ADMIN_TOKEN=ey... ./scripts/admin-mfa-reset-all.sh # # Required: a JWT bearer token belonging to a user whose `users.is_admin = TRUE`. set -euo pipefail API_URL="${API_URL:-http://localhost:8000}" ADMIN_TOKEN="${ADMIN_TOKEN:-}" if [ -z "$ADMIN_TOKEN" ]; then read -rsp "Admin Bearer token (user with is_admin=TRUE): " ADMIN_TOKEN echo fi if [ -z "$ADMIN_TOKEN" ]; then echo "ERROR: no admin token provided." >&2 exit 1 fi cat <<'WARN' ======================================================================== WARNING — IRREVERSIBLE BULK ACTION ======================================================================== This will: * set mfa_enabled = FALSE for every user * delete every backup code * invalidate all pending MFA login challenges and enrollments * write a permanent entry to user_activity_logs After this, all users can sign in with username/password only and must re-enroll MFA from the Users page. ======================================================================== WARN read -rp "Type 'yes' to proceed: " confirm1 if [ "$confirm1" != "yes" ]; then echo "Aborted." exit 1 fi read -rp "Type 'RESET ALL MFA' (exact) to confirm: " confirm2 if [ "$confirm2" != "RESET ALL MFA" ]; then echo "Aborted." exit 1 fi read -rp "Reason (logged in audit): " reason if [ -z "$reason" ]; then echo "Aborted: reason is required." exit 1 fi # Compose JSON safely (python3 for proper JSON escaping; reliably available # everywhere the backend already runs). payload=$(python3 -c " import json, sys print(json.dumps({'confirm': 'RESET ALL MFA', 'reason': sys.argv[1]})) " "$reason") echo "Calling $API_URL/api/mfa/admin-reset-all ..." http_response=$(curl -fsS -X POST "$API_URL/api/mfa/admin-reset-all" \ -H "Authorization: Bearer $ADMIN_TOKEN" \ -H "Content-Type: application/json" \ -d "$payload") echo "$http_response" echo echo "Done. Verify in user_activity_logs: action='mfa.disabled.admin_bulk_reset'."
